Setting Clear Expectations

Every great partnership thrives on communication. As a first-time sugar daddy, you can really help define what the relationship entails right from the get-go. This means discussing expectations—what you wish to offer and what you’re hoping to receive in return.

It might feel a bit awkward at first, similar to being on a first date waiting for the server to bring your drinks while making small talk. You could say something like, “I’m interested in a fun and lighthearted relationship where we can both explore and enjoy life. What are you looking for in this arrangement?” This opens the door for honest dialogue.

Emphasizing Respect and Honesty

As with any relationship, respect and honesty should ride shotgun. It’s about understanding that both parties deserve the best version of each other. If either of you feels off about the arrangement, it’s essential to bring it up immediately. Picture this: You’ve been on a few dates, and your companion seems a bit distracted, perhaps texting during dinner. Instead of stewing in irritation, why not gently ask, “Is everything alright? You seem a bit preoccupied.” Open communication helps build a much stronger bond.
